Output 76616af26559bf67ceef0d61c9cc7568c6c0788f06c1f8e44b250f213d4e595a:1

value
1843952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9e4d35541b9c875a2199534a1b97536bd931055 OP_EQUALVERIFY OP_CHECKSIG
address
1Hwv8ZjrbR8gy6x7xWYhk3W6YEieuZCRqB
transaction
76616af26559bf67ceef0d61c9cc7568c6c0788f06c1f8e44b250f213d4e595a
spent
true